The days of the glossy paper new car brochure are numbered, it would appear.

If you’re looking to buy a 2012 Mercedes-Benz C Class in the U.K., there’s no need to waste your time visiting a dealer to pick up a printed brochure.

Instead, you can simply download a new iPad app that gives you a virtual and interactive overview of the new Mercedes-Benz C Class lineup. Rather than just providing pictures and text, the app allows shoppers to compare models side-by-side, while viewing the selected cars from multiple angles.

An interactive configurator allows consumers to view various interior and exterior options, and the app contains driving videos for each C Class variant. There are detailed explanations of features like Mercedes’ Intelligent Light System, its Dynamic Handling Package, and BlueEFFICIENCY features that come on every C Class model.

The app contains all the specifications you’d find in a hard copy brochure, too, and even includes pricing data. When it’s time to buy, the app will use your current location to find the nearest dealer, who will contact you with an as-configured price on your new C Class.

Prefer another shop? No problem, since the app allows you to select the dealer of your choice, as well.

The app is available on both iTunes and the Mercedes-Benz UK website. For now, it’s not available to U.S. shoppers, but we suspect that will soon change. Interactive brochures are less expensive and more feature-rich than printed ones, so it’s just a matter of time before manufacturers embrace new car brochure apps.
